环境准备与服务器配置
在阿里云上搭建VPN前,需完成以下准备工作:
- 购买ECS实例:选择具有公网IP的云服务器,推荐使用CentOS或Ubuntu系统;
- 配置安全组:开放VPN服务所需端口(如UDP 1194),限制来源IP范围;
- 选择服务器地域:根据需求选择中国大陆或海外节点(如香港)以优化网络延迟。
VPN服务安装与配置
以OpenVPN为例,安装与配置流程如下:
- 安装依赖环境:执行
wget -O openvpn-install.sh https://git.io/vpn
下载安装脚本; - 生成证书文件:使用easy-rsa工具创建CA证书、服务器及客户端密钥;
- 配置服务端参数:编辑
server.conf
文件,设置协议类型、隧道模式及IP地址池; - 启动VPN服务:通过
systemctl start openvpn@server
命令激活服务。
安全策略与访问控制
为确保VPN服务安全性,需实施以下措施:
- 启用双因素认证:在阿里云控制台配置RAM用户访问策略;
- 定期轮换密钥:每90天更新CA证书与客户端密钥;
- 限制访问权限:通过安全组仅允许授权IP地址连接管理端口;
- 启用日志审计:使用阿里云日志服务监控VPN连接行为。
连接测试与日常维护
完成部署后需进行验证与维护:
- 客户端连接测试:使用OpenVPN GUI或Tunnelblick导入配置文件,检查IP地址是否切换成功;
- 网络性能测试:通过
ping
和traceroute
验证隧道稳定性; - 定期更新补丁:使用
yum update
或apt upgrade
升级系统及VPN组件。
在阿里云上搭建VPN需综合服务器配置、服务部署及安全策略,通过标准化安装脚本可快速完成基础环境搭建,而结合阿里云原生安全产品(如安全组、日志服务)能有效提升整体防护能力。建议企业用户采用证书认证与IP白名单机制实现精细化访问控制。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/439936.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。